- It's finally happening! What? No! Paul, Jason, & June break down M. Night Shyamalan's 2008 thriller The Happening-a movie where the trees are out to get us and Mark Wahlberg & Zooey Deschanel run away from wind. LIVE from Largo in LA, they discuss the talking plant scene, Marky Mark's mood ring, an A+ Jeremy Strong performance, Johnny Legs' bad parenting, and so much more. Plus, June takes a hard stance on people who go out to eat for dessert only. DISCLAIMER: Despite what you hear in this episode, this is NOT a cheese podcast.
